Output 43265864037e1bc8db7845950c8c1e7b457b13f71b7aab9d620596d01f579c92:0

value
63000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f6c9b331640c89f01d5a241d93d6963260a57f9 OP_EQUAL
address
3K9B6H4j3HMUQwEKUxnXWu3n3zYPvwAJUU
transaction
43265864037e1bc8db7845950c8c1e7b457b13f71b7aab9d620596d01f579c92
spent
true